Detailed Review
Neon Digital Clock Smart Watch by Lutech Ltd presents a specialized utility application for Android devices that transforms the smartphone into a persistent time display. The app occupies a niche position in the utility market by addressing specific scenarios where users require immediate time visibility without device interaction. With a 3.9-star rating on the Google Play Store, the application focuses on minimalist functionality rather than comprehensive smartwatch emulation.
The core functionality centers on two primary features: an always-on neon-style digital clock display and a night mode function. The application bypasses standard lock screen protocols to maintain time visibility even when the device is in sleep mode. The neon aesthetic employs high-contrast coloration with glowing effects designed for visibility in various lighting conditions. Additional functionality includes date display and customizable color schemes, though advanced features like notifications or health tracking are notably absent compared to full smartwatch companion applications.
User experience demonstrates both practical utility and limitations. The interface operates with minimal interaction—users launch the application once to activate persistent display mode. Real-world testing shows effective performance during activities like cycling or driving, where glancing at a phone-mounted display proves safer than handling the device. However, battery consumption concerns emerge during extended use, particularly with screen brightness at higher levels. The night clock feature functions adequately for bedside use, though ambient light sensors and automatic brightness adjustment appear limited to system-level controls rather than app-specific optimization.

The application demonstrates clear strengths in specialized use cases but faces limitations in broader functionality. Battery impact remains the most significant concern, particularly for users seeking all-day display functionality. Ideal implementation involves situational usage rather than continuous operation. The app serves specific needs effectively but cannot replace full smartwatch functionality or comprehensive always-on display systems found in native smartphone features.
